Keiichiro Kashimura is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Mechanical Engineering and Ceramics and Composites. According to data from OpenAlex, Keiichiro Kashimura has authored 45 papers receiving a total of 476 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Organic Chemistry, 18 papers in Mechanical Engineering and 11 papers in Ceramics and Composites. Recurrent topics in Keiichiro Kashimura’s work include Microwave-Assisted Synthesis and Applications (26 papers), Advanced ceramic materials synthesis (11 papers) and Electromagnetic wave absorption materials (7 papers). Keiichiro Kashimura is often cited by papers focused on Microwave-Assisted Synthesis and Applications (26 papers), Advanced ceramic materials synthesis (11 papers) and Electromagnetic wave absorption materials (7 papers). Keiichiro Kashimura collaborates with scholars based in Japan and United States. Keiichiro Kashimura's co-authors include Tomohiko Mitani, Motoyasu Sato, Kazuhiro Nagata, Naoki Shinohara, Miyuki Hayashi, Jun Fukushima, Takashi Fujii, Kohei Takeda, Noboru Yoshikawa and Hirotsugu Takizawa and has published in prestigious journals such as Environmental Science & Technology, Applied Physics Letters and Journal of Applied Physics.
